Suzani embroidery has a rich history & goes back centuries to a time when Afghanistan, Uzbekistan, Tajikistan & Iran were part of a single state, & the western historical city of Herat in Afghanistan & Samarkand in Uzbekistan was the capital of the huge empire. Ruy Gonzles de Clavijo, the Castilian ambassador to the court of Amir Timur, wrote extensive descriptions of embroidered suzani textiles for the high place it held in the culture & art of countries along the silk road. The art of Suzani embroidery is very unique to each family, has extremely important cultural value & passed on from mothers to daughters. Women made beautifully embroidered cushion covers, wall hangings, bed covers, wrapping cloths, table covers, & prayer mats for their households & use it for their daughters' dowries & as gifts to rulers, important guests & friends. Suzani embroidery has a large variety of patterns, which traditionally include the sun & moon, flowers & creepers of the Asian steppes, leaves & vines, fruits (especially pomegranates, which is considered the fruit of life). These motifs are believed to imbue the suzanis with spiritual powers, offering protection or strength to their owners.
